Cornerstone roots: The original sounding roots band from Raglan, New Zealand with music that is message orientated, bass driven, soul induced … the quiet stalwarts of Kiwi reggae for the past nine years. These guys will be playing at the Byron Bay Brewery Buddha Bar on Saturday. Tickets are $16 pre bought, or $20 on the night! I highly recommend these guys, I have personally seen them in NZ a few times and they are wicked live act.
